Mindfulness Through Papercraft
In today's fast-paced world, finding moments of peace is more important than ever. Papercraft offers a unique and engaging way to cultivate mindfulness. By focusing on the intricate elements of paper folding and cutting, we can quiet our minds and enter a state of deep focus. The repetitive movements involved in papercraft provide a soothing rhythm that prompts us to be present in the moment.
- Intriguing patterns and designs offer endless opportunities for imagination.
- Papercraft projects vary from simple to complex, making it accessible to those new to the craft.
- Completing a papercraft project brings a sense of accomplishment.
Consequently, papercraft can be a valuable tool for reducing stress and anxiety, while also promoting our overall well-being.
Origami's Therapeutic Fold: Exploring Paper Craft for Wellbeing
Origami, the ancient art of paper folding, has recently gained recognition as a powerful tool for enhancing wellbeing. Sculpting paper into intricate shapes can be a deeply calming experience, helping to reduce tension.
The focus required for origami encourages mindfulness, allowing individuals to disconnect from everyday worries. The creative nature of the activity can also elevate self-esteem and belief. Moreover, origami can be a social activity, providing an opportunity for engagement with others.
